JERUSALEM (Nov. 17) - Security guards on board an El Al flight have foiled a hijacking attempt, Israel radio says.
The flight was headed from Tel Aviv to Istanbul, Turkey.
Officials at the Istanbul airport say the hijacker was overpowered by security guards and no one was hurt. The suspect is in custody. The plane landed safely in Istanbul.
Israeli radio stations said the man tried to take hostage a cabin attendant and that he was unarmed.
The reports said 170 passengers were on board.
An official at Istanbul's Ataturk International Airport said El Al flight 581 sent out a hijacking signal as it approached Istanbul.
''No one was injured,'' Oktay Cakirlar said.''The terrorist is in custody at the police staion at the airport.''
